Output 2961f74c32b48cc4af784775af3e2ce23649d5038e4bc2ab5c7534bb713c3837:4

value
64941288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042aa7b31997a99f27de4bfe306037abd30a3988 OP_EQUAL
address
M8HC2vZE6akjMvcZEnQMDt8227UqfBXabZ
transaction
2961f74c32b48cc4af784775af3e2ce23649d5038e4bc2ab5c7534bb713c3837
spent
true